Automatisez la conversion ODT en PPT avec GroupDocs.Conversion pour .NET

Introduction

Vous avez des difficultés à convertir manuellement des fichiers ODT (Open Document Text) en présentations PowerPoint ? Automatisez le processus en toute simplicité grâce à GroupDocs.Conversion pour .NET. Ce guide étape par étape vous aidera à utiliser la bibliothèque GroupDocs.Conversion pour convertir efficacement des fichiers ODT au format PPT.

Ce que vous apprendrez :

  • Configuration et intégration de GroupDocs.Conversion dans vos projets .NET.
  • Instructions étape par étape pour convertir des fichiers ODT en présentations PowerPoint.
  • Bonnes pratiques pour optimiser les performances et gérer les ressources.

Commençons par nous assurer que vous disposez de tous les prérequis !

Prérequis

Avant de commencer, assurez-vous d’avoir :

  • Bibliothèques requises : GroupDocs.Conversion pour .NET. Installez-le via NuGet ou .NET CLI.
  • Configuration requise pour l’environnement : Un environnement de développement avec prise en charge du framework .NET.
  • Prérequis en matière de connaissances : Compréhension de base de C# et de la gestion des fichiers dans .NET.

Configuration de GroupDocs.Conversion pour .NET

Pour commencer, vous devez installer la bibliothèque GroupDocs.Conversion en utilisant l’une de ces méthodes :

Utilisation de la console du gestionnaire de packages N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

Utilisation de .N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Acquisition de licence : Commencez par obtenir un essai gratuit ou demandez une licence temporaire pour explorer toutes les fonctionnalités. Pour une utilisation à long terme, pensez à acheter une licence.

Initialisation et configuration de base : Voici comment initialiser votre environnement de conversion à l’aide de C# :

using System;
using GroupDocs.Conversion;

// Initialiser le convertisseur
string sourceFilePath = \@"path\\to\\your\\sample.odt";
var converter = new Converter(sourceFilePath);

Guide de mise en œuvre

Dans cette section, nous vous guiderons à travers chaque étape de la conversion d’un fichier ODT en présentation PowerPoint.

Présentation des fonctionnalités : Conversion ODT en PPT

Cette fonctionnalité automatise le processus de conversion des documents. Décomposons-la en étapes faciles à gérer :

Étape 1 : Définir les chemins d’accès et les répertoires des fichiers

Définissez les chemins de votre document et de votre répertoire de sortie pour organiser les fichiers sources et stocker les sorties converties.

string documentDirectory = \@"Y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= \@"YOUR_OUTPUT_DIRECTORY";

// Définir le chemin du fichier source
string sourceFilePath = Path.Combine(documentDirectory, "sample.odt");

Étape 2 : Charger le fichier ODT source

Utilisez GroupDocs.Conversion pour charger votre fichier ODT. Cette étape prépare le document pour la conversion.

using (var converter = new Converter(sourceFilePath))
{
    // La logique de conversion ira ici
}

Étape 3 : Configurer les options de conversion

Indiquez que vous souhaitez convertir en présentation PowerPoint et définissez des options supplémentaires si nécessaire.

PresentationConvertOptions options = new PresentationConvertOptions {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Ppt };

Étape 4 : Exécuter la conversion

Effectuez la conversion et enregistrez votre fichier PPT dans le répertoire de sortie spécifié.

string outputFile = Path.Combine(outputDirectory, "odt-converted-to.ppt");
converter.Convert(outputFile, options);

Conseils de dépannage :

  • Assurez-vous que les chemins sont correctement définis pour éviter FileNotFoundException.
  • Vérifiez que l’espace disque est suffisant avant la conversion pour éviter les erreurs.

Applications pratiques

GroupDocs.Conversion peut être intégré à divers systèmes et frameworks .NET. Voici quelques cas d’utilisation concrets :

  1. Rapports d’entreprise : Convertissez les notes de réunion d’ODT en PPT pour les présentations.
  2. Création de contenu éducatif : Transformez les plans de cours ou les supports de cours en diapositives.
  3. Automatisation du marketing : Convertissez rapidement des brouillons de texte en présentations attrayantes.

Considérations relatives aux performances

Pour garantir des performances optimales, tenez compte de ces conseils :

  • Surveillez l’utilisation des ressources pendant les processus de conversion.
  • Optimisez la gestion de la mémoire en supprimant rapidement les objets avec using déclarations.
  • Pour les conversions par lots volumineuses, implémentez un traitement asynchrone ou multithread.

Conclusion

Vous maîtrisez désormais la conversion de fichiers ODT en PPT avec GroupDocs.Conversion pour .NET. Ce guide vous présente les étapes et les points à prendre en compte pour une mise en œuvre efficace. Explorez les fonctionnalités supplémentaires de la bibliothèque pour optimiser vos flux de gestion documentaire.

Prêt à faire passer vos processus de conversion au niveau supérieur ? Essayez d’implémenter cette solution dans votre prochain projet !

Section FAQ

Q1 : Puis-je convertir plusieurs fichiers ODT à la fois ? A1 : Oui, en parcourant un répertoire de fichiers ODT et en appliquant la même logique de conversion.

Q2 : Quels formats GroupDocs.Conversion peut-il gérer en plus de PPT ? A2 : Il prend en charge plus de 50 formats de fichiers, dont PDF, Word, Excel, etc. Consultez la référence de l’API pour plus de détails.

Q3 : Comment gérer les licences pour GroupDocs.Conversion ? A3 : Commencez par un essai gratuit ou une licence temporaire pour évaluer les fonctionnalités avant d’acheter.

Q4 : Quels sont les problèmes courants lors de la conversion ? A4 : Les erreurs de chemin d’accès aux fichiers et le manque de mémoire sont fréquents. Assurez-vous que les chemins sont corrects et surveillez les ressources système.

Q5 : Ce processus peut-il être automatisé dans un environnement serveur ? A5 : Absolument ! GroupDocs.Conversion peut être intégré aux systèmes back-end pour une gestion automatisée des documents.

Ressources

Grâce à ce guide, vous serez parfaitement équipé pour intégrer GroupDocs.Conversion à vos projets .NET et optimiser vos processus de conversion de documents. Bon codage !